About the Authors



Michael J. Etzel received his Ph.D. in marketing from the University of Colorado. Since 1980, he has been a professor of marketing at the University of Notre Dame. He also has been on the faculties at Utah State University and the University of Kentucky. He has held visiting faculty positions at the University of South Carolina and the University of Hawaii. In 1990, he was a Fulbright Fellow at the University of Innsbruck, Austria. His other overseas assignments include directing and teaching in the University of Notre Dame’s program in Fremantle, Australia, in 1994, and the University’s London MBA program in 1998.

Professor Etzel has taught marketing courses from the introductory through the doctoral level. He received a Kaneb undergraduate teaching award from the University of Notre Dame in 2001. His research, primarily in marketing management and buyer behavior, has appeared in the Journal of Marketing, Journal of Marketing Research, Journal of Consumer Research, and other publications. He is the coauthor of another college-level text, Retailing Today. He has been active in many aspects of the American Marketing Association at the local and national levels. He served as chairman of AMA’s board in 1996–1997.

Bruce J. Walker became professor of marketing and dean of the College of Business at the University of Missouri–Columbia in 1990. Professor Walker received his undergraduate degree in economics from Seattle University and his master’s and Ph.D. degrees in business from the University of Colorado.

Professor Walker was a member of the marketing faculties at the University of Kentucky and then at Arizona State University. Dr. Walker has taught a variety of courses, including principles of marketing. His research, focusing primarily on franchising, marketing channels, and survey-research methods, has been published in the Journal of Marketing, Journal of Marketing Research, and other periodicals. He has also coedited or coauthored conference proceedings and books, including Retailing Today. Dr. Walker has been involved with the American Marketing Association, including serving as vice president of the Education Division. Currently, he is a trustee for the International Franchise Association’s Education Foundation and a member of several corporate boards including Salton, Inc., an international housewares company.

William J. Stanton is professor emeritus of marketing at the University of Colorado– Boulder. He received his Ph.D. in marketing from Northwestern University, where he was elected to Beta Gamma Sigma. He has worked in business and has taught in several management development programs for marketing executives. He has served as a consultant for various business organizations and has engaged in research projects for the federal government. Professor Stanton also has lectured at universities in Europe, Asia, Mexico, and New Zealand.

A coauthor of the leading text in sales management, Professor Stanton has also published several journal articles and monographs. Marketing has been translated into Spanish, and separate editions have been adapted (with coauthors) for Canada, Italy, Australia, and South Africa. In a survey of marketing educators, Professor Stanton was voted one of the leaders in marketing thought. And he is listed in Who’s Who in America and Who’s Who in the World.

Ajay Pandit is Professor, School of Economics and Management, Hainan University, Haikou, Hainan, China. Before joining Hainan University, he was Dean and Professor at School of Management Studies, Guru Gobind Singh Indraprastha University (GGSIPU) on deputation from Faculty of Management Studies (FMS), Delhi University. Prof Pandit has been on the faculty of FMS, a top 10 Bschool in the country, for more that 20 years. He did his BE, MBA, LLB and PhD from University of Delhi. Dr. Pandit is a brilliant academic, an avid researcher, a prolific writer, a consultant, and an institution builder, all rolled into one. He has been bestowed upon the “Higher Education and Development Award” by the International association of Educators for World Peace (an UN-affiliated NGO) at the Higher Education and Development Summit held at New Delhi in April 2004. Dr. Pandit has to his credit many research papers, articles and 4 books. He has guided several students into completing their PhDs.
